Transaction 34a2a4dc202f7e81ce6f1c04b10a74ff126c212abd5524aabd7b1b6830dc425b
1 Input
2 Outputs
- 34a2a4dc202f7e81ce6f1c04b10a74ff126c212abd5524aabd7b1b6830dc425b:0
- 34a2a4dc202f7e81ce6f1c04b10a74ff126c212abd5524aabd7b1b6830dc425b:1
value 694343754
address 1ANFBhxsVerkf9m8sd8GvrMqcCbezvY3GM
value 17989074
address 354t8AFYUUXZyQWS8qvuJbHCfKNuUPiRbh